
- •Выбор средств проектирования субд
- •1.1 Общие требования к информационной системе
- •1.2 Особенности работы субд
- •1.3 Описание субд
- •Технологии доступа к данным
- •1.5 Реализация информационной системы
- •1.6 Описание программных средств.
- •Построение er-диаграммы
- •2.1 Диаграмма «сущность» - «связь»
- •Нормализация er - диаграммы в реляционную модель
- •Описание алгоритма обработки информации
- •3.1 Создания базы данных Access 2007
- •3.1.1 Создание таблиц
- •3.1.2Установка логических связей между таблицами
- •3.2 Создание форм
- •3.3 Создание запроса для выборки информации из таблиц
- •Описание интерфейса
- •Создание Web – cтраницы
- •Описание технических средств
- •Защита и сохранность данных
- •Технико-экономическая характеристика предметной области.
- •9. Особенности использования электронно-вычислительной техники в учете.
- •Оптимизация бухучета
3.3 Создание запроса для выборки информации из таблиц
Создание Запросов осуществляется с помощью Мастера запросов. В окне Новый запрос выберите Простой запрос и нажмите кнопку ОК.В открывшемся окне Создание простых запросов выберите из таблиц базы данных нужные поля и нажмите кнопку Далее.
При нажатии на кнопку Запросы в области Объекты и кнопку Создать панели инструментов окна База данных.
В следующем окне Создание простых запросов оставьте помеченным переключатель подробный и нажмите кнопку Далее.
В последнем окне Создание простых запросов задайте имя запроса – «ЗАРПЛАТА запрос», пометьте переключатель Изменить макет запроса и нажмите кнопку Готово.
На экране появится окно конструктора запросов .
Нижняя часть окна (Надстройка) содержит поля исходных таблиц, которые вы поместили в созданный запрос. Если Вы хотите удалить поле из таблицы-запроса, выделите столбец, соответствующий ему в надстройке, и нажмите клавишу Delete. Для помещения нового поля в таблицу-запрос зацепите мышкой имя нужного поля на схеме и, удерживая левую кнопку нажатой, перетащите название поля в надстройку или выделите столбец, перед которым нужно вставить новое поле, далее из меню Вставка выберите команду Столбец.
В созданной таблице-запросе отсутствуют поля «Дети СУММ», «Начислено», «Уральский коэффициент» и т.д. Любым из описанных способов добавьте их в таблицу-запрос.
В
таблице-запросе поля «Дети СУММ»,
«Начислено», «Уральский коэффициент»
и т.д. вычисляемые, для определения
содержимого поля Сумма надстройки
поместите в него курсор и нажмите кнопку
Построить
на панели инструментов окна Microsoft
Access.
После этого на экране появится окно Построитель выражений .
Общие
сведения о построителе выражений
В области Элементы выражений окна Построителя выражений находятся три поля.
В левом поле показываются папки, содержащие таблицы, запросы, формы, объекты базы данных, встроенные и определенные пользователем функции, константы, операторы и общие выражения.
В среднем поле задаются определенные элементы или типы элементов для папки, заданной в левом поле. Например, если выбрать в левом поле таблицу из папки Таблицы, то в среднем поле появится список всех полей этой таблицы.
В правом поле выводится список значений (если они существуют) для элементов, заданных левым и средним полями
Порядок создания выражения:
В поле Элементы БД, функции и др. при раскрытии списка таблиц и выбора нужной таблицы, в поле Категории элементов выбираем нужное поле, двойным нажатие кнопкой мыши, для того чтобы вставить его в Поле построителя выражений, или нажатием кнопки Вставить.
После выбора всех необходимые операторы в выражение. Для этого поместите указатель мыши в определенную позицию Поля построителя выражений и выберите одну из кнопок оператора.
После создания выражения нажмите кнопку ОК окна Построитель выражений. Тем самым возвращаясь в окно конструктора запросов. В Надстройке появится созданное выражение, редактируем при необходимости.
После формирования вычисляемых полей необходимо закрыть конструктор запросов. Откройте запрос и вы увидите примерно следующее:
Надстройка позволяет также задать способ сортировки и группировки данных по различным полям. Для задания сортировки выберите нужный способ в окне Сортировать для соответствующего поля таблицы-запроса.
Создание отчетов
Для того чтобы иметь возможность распечатать данные, имеющиеся в базе данных, используются отчеты, с помощью «Мастер отчетов» расположенной на ленте «Создать».
В процессе работы «Мастер отчетов» предлагает выбрать из списка доступные поля, для чего можно воспользоваться стрелками влево и вправо, выделяя нужную строку из списка курсором, в правую часть все доступные поля.
На
следующем этапе существует возможность
сортировки информации в будущем отчете.
Далее выбираем «Табличный» макет и книжную ориентацию бумаги, т.к. число полей в таблице не большое и она легко разместиться на странице достаточно крупным шрифтом.
Следующий этап «Мастера отчетов» предполагает выбор стиля (т.е. внешнего вида будущего отчета) – выберете тот, который больше подходит.
На завершающем этапе вы должны выбрать удобное для вас имя отчета и, либо просмотреть готовый отчет, либо перейти к редактированию, выбрав команду «Изменить макет отчета». Выбираем последний вариант.
Данный выбор связан с тем, что Мастер отчетов создал поле «Список сотрудников» очень малой ширины при том, что справа на листе есть свободное место.
Устанавливаем курсор мыши на правой части поля «ФИО» в «Области данных», нажимаем левую кнопку мыши и перемещаем границу поля до желаемой ширины, т.е. изменяем ширину ячейки в таблице. После этого действия щелкаем мышью на команде «Режим» в левой части ленты «Конструктор» и переключаемся в режим просмотра полученного отчета.
Аналогично
создаем отчет для таблицы «Зарплата
общая отчетность», «Премия», «Премия +
Сотрудники», «Список сотрудников».
Отчеты могут отличаться только выбранным
стилем, количеством выбранных полей.